Nomura Holdings's Q1 2014 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2014, Nomura Holdings held 3,142 positions worth $326B, up 1,389% from $21.9B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 90% of the portfolio.

Nomura Holdings deployed $317B of net new capital in Q1 2014, opening 1,181 new positions and adding to 774 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was TOWERS WATSON & CO COM STK CL A (DE): 210,899 shares worth $24.1M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 0.7% of assets, down from 12%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Technology.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was State Street S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ust, an estimated $1.68B trimmed.
